首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
通过派生类的对象可直接访问其( )。
通过派生类的对象可直接访问其( )。
admin
2019-06-12
46
问题
通过派生类的对象可直接访问其( )。
选项
A、公有继承基类的公有成员
B、公有继承基类的私有成员
C、私有继承基类的公有成员
D、私有继承基类的私有成员
答案
A
解析
基类的私有成员在派生类中都是不能访问的,所以选项B、D是错误的,基类的公有成员通过私有继承后,在派生类中变为了私有成员,只能在派生类中进行访问,而通过派生类的对象不能访问,所以选项C也是错误的。基类的公有成员通过公有继承后,在派生类中是公有成员,所以可以通过派生对象来访问。
转载请注明原文地址:https://www.kaotiyun.com/show/IH8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下程序:#includeusingnamespacestd;classsample{private:intx,y;public:sample(inti,intj)
在包含1000个元素的线性表中实现如下各运算,所需的执行时间最长的是()。
下列程序将x、y和z按从小到大的顺序排列,请将下面的函数模板补充完整。template<classT>voidorder(______){Ta;if(x>y){a=x;
不能重载的运算符是
对于派生类的构造函数,在定义对象时构造函数的执行顺序:先执行调用______的构造函数,再执行调用子对象类的构造函数,最后执行派生类的构造函数体中的内容。
下列关于类与对象的说法中,不正确的是()。
C++中封装性、继承性和______是面向对象思想的主要特征。
在结构化程序设计中,模块划分的原则是A)各模块应包括尽量多的功能B)各模块的规模应尽量大C)各模块之间的联系应尽量紧密D)模块内具有高内聚度,模块间具有低耦合度
在表达式x+y*z中,+是作为成员函数重载的运算符,*是作为非成员函数重载的运算符。下列叙述中正确的是()。
对建立良好的程序设计风格,下面描述正确的是()。
随机试题
CO2气体保护横焊时,由于熔融金属受重力作用,焊缝的下侧易产生()缺陷。
心脏骤停早期诊断的最佳指标是
实心圆轴受扭,若将轴的直径减小一半时,则圆轴的扭转角是原来的()倍。
一个路段的监控系统是根据道路的特点、桥梁与隧道等大型构造物的分布、交通量以及()等因素来构架本路段的监控系统。
邮寄申报的实际申报日期应当为()。
下列关于货币政策的目标说法正确的是()。①货币政策作为总需求管理工具,在维护金融稳定方面具有一定局限性②货币中介目标选取的标准不同于操作目标③货币政策中介目标在是选取利率还是货币供应量上存在争议④操作目标的选择在很大程度上取决于
产权是对特定物的()并排除他人干涉的权利。
一战期间,陈独秀等人在上海出版的一份以青年为对象的刊物,发刊词中有这样的两句话:“笃古不变之族,日久衰亡;日新求进之旅,方兴未已。”作者“求变”主要针对:
Inanew【C1】________publishedinthejournalHeart,researchersfoundthatSwissadultswhotookoneortwodaytimenapsperwee
中国是世界上公认发明指南针的国家。早在2400多年前,中国人就创造出世界上最早的指南针。后来经过不断改进,到宋朝(theSongDynasty)人们制造出铁针指南针并应用于航海。中国是第一个在海船上使用指南针的国家。指南针为明代(theMingDy
最新回复
(
0
)